FIRST.bet, a top sportsbook technology provider, has strengthened its senior team with a new addition. On Monday, the company revealed that it has brought on Ian Bradley, a former executive at DraftKings and SBTech.

Bradley joins the company as co-CEO and partner

Bradley is set to take on the role of co-CEO at FIRST.bet and will also partner with the company's founder, Tom Light. Both have extensive experience from their time at SBTech, a testament to their knack for building successful sports betting ventures. With over 20 years in the sportsbook and trading industry, Bradley brings a wealth of knowledge to his new position. Before joining FIRST.bet, he was Senior Vice President at DraftKings, where he focused on enhancing their consumer sportsbook revenue. His career began with Sporting Index and Sporting Solutions in spread betting and trading before he joined SBTech. This experience proved pivotal when SBTech merged with DraftKings in 2020, enhancing the latter's capabilities. Now at FIRST.bet, Bradley is not only stepping into a leadership role but also collaborating closely with Light, aiming to spearhead the company's expansion across Latin America, Europe, and other regulated markets. FIRST.bet has crafted something extraordinary—a top-notch team and superior technology. I’m eager to contribute to their ongoing success, Bradley expressed in a press release. He further noted, Leading alongside Tom as co-CEO is the challenge I've been looking for, especially given the vast opportunities in the B2B sector. Tom Light, co-CEO and founder of FIRST.bet, echoed this enthusiasm, celebrating Bradley as a highly respected industry leader. Having previously worked with Bradley at SBTech, Light was eager to welcome him aboard, emphasizing that DraftKings' reluctance to let him go highlights his value. Light concluded, Having Ian join me as co-CEO signals our intent to build a platform that attracts serious operators, and together we’ll reach our goals faster.
